Abstract

A kind of mineral resources acquisition monitoring system, including the analysis of background monitoring terminal, data and processing module, data acquisition module, GIS mineral products display systems and mine car real-time monitoring system;GIS mineral products display systems include mineral resources information display module, relate to mine company information display module and pressures on ecology and environment display module;Mine car real-time monitoring system includes the car-mounted terminal being mounted on mine car and the communication module with data acquisition module communication connection;Face recognition module, fatigue driving detection module, mine car overload warning module, vehicle condition information acquisition module and locating module are provided on car-mounted terminal;Data acquisition module is used for collecting data information;Data analysis and processing module are analyzed and processed collected data and are sent in background monitoring terminal;The present invention can be monitored the mineral resources in monitoring range, while reduce security risk, improve the supervision and utilization rate of mineral resources.

Specific embodiment
In order to make the objectives, technical solutions and advantages of the present invention clearer, With reference to embodiment and join According to attached drawing, the present invention is described in more detail.It should be understood that these descriptions are merely illustrative, and it is not intended to limit this hair Bright range.In addition, in the following description, descriptions of well-known structures and technologies are omitted, to avoid this is unnecessarily obscured The concept of invention.
As shown in Figure 1, a kind of mineral resources proposed by the present invention acquire monitoring system, including background monitoring terminal 5, data Analysis and processing module 4, data acquisition module 3, GIS mineral products display systems 1 and mine car real-time monitoring system 2;
GIS mineral products display systems 1 include mineral resources information display module 101, relate to mine company information display module 102 and ecology Environmental information display module 103;GIS mineral products display systems 1 further include the communication module with 3 communication connection of data acquisition module;
Mine car real-time monitoring system 2 include the car-mounted terminal 201 that is mounted on mine car and with 3 communication connection of data acquisition module Communication module;Face recognition module 202, fatigue driving detection module 203, mine car overload are provided on car-mounted terminal 201 in advance Alert module 204, vehicle condition information acquisition module 205 and locating module 206;The driver identity for identification of face recognition module 202; Fatigue driving detection module 203 is used to detect the fatigue state of driver, judges whether fatigue driving;Mine car overload warning module 204 for detecting mine car with the presence or absence of overload behavior;Vehicle condition information acquisition module 205 is used to acquire the situation of remote of mine car, packet Include vehicle continuously drive mileage, total kilometres, continuously drive duration, tire pressure, engine condition, gearbox state and away from From last time service time information;Locating module 206 is used to record position, route and the speed per hour information of vehicle operation;
Data acquisition module 3 and data are analyzed and processing module 4 is arranged in background server, and data acquisition module 3 is used for The data information of GIS mineral products display systems 1 and mine car real-time monitoring system 2 is acquired, and is sent to data analysis and processing module 4 In;Data analysis and processing module 4 are analyzed and processed collected data and are sent in background monitoring terminal 5.
In an alternative embodiment, background monitoring terminal 5 includes abnormal alarm module 501 and display output module 502;Abnormal alarm module 501 includes combined aural and visual alarm and SMS alarming device, for issuing sound and light alarm signal and short message report Alert alarm.
In an alternative embodiment, display 502 communication connection of output module is to multiple displays, for showing monitoring Information.
In an alternative embodiment, locating module 206 includes GPS positioning device and BDS positioning device, location information It is more accurate, convenient for obtaining position and the speed per hour information of vehicle operation.
In an alternative embodiment, the ECU of car-mounted terminal 201 and vehicle, which is controlled, connects, for opening or closing vehicle Hazard warning lamp, when running state of the vehicle occurs abnormal, car-mounted terminal 201, which controls vehicle, to be opened danger warning and dodges Light lamp prompts vehicular traffic note that preventing safety accident.
In the present invention, the displaying content of GIS mineral products display systems 1, including mineral resources are acquired by data acquisition module 3 Location distribution, ore reserve, classification, class information, the essential information of each area She Kuang enterprise, minery underground Water quality, soil pollutant content, air pollutant concentration information;Judge whether there is environmental pollution, the exceeded exploitation of mineral products etc. Information;Warning message is sent by abnormal alarm module 501 if exception occurs in monitoring data and finds security risk in time;
Each mine car is numbered, face recognition module 202 is first passed through in mining and identifies driver identity information, it The driver tired driving state fed back afterwards according to the fatigue driving detection module 203 of mine car;It is overloaded warning module by mine car Whether 204 monitoring mine cars overload, to judge whether there is the case where excavating in violation of rules and regulations;Car-mounted terminal 201 sends vehicle fortune later Row information includes that vehicle continuously drives mileage, total kilometres, continuously drives duration, tire pressure, engine condition, gearbox State and apart from last time service time information to data acquisition module 3, whether the operating status of comprehensive descision mine car is abnormal, if There is the abnormal abnormal alarm module 501 that then passes through and send warning message to car-mounted terminal 201, car-mounted terminal 201 controls vehicle and opens Hazard warning lamp prompt vehicular traffic is opened note that preventing safety accident;Background monitoring terminal 5 can find different in time Normal state, staff remind driver to avoid safety accident in time by modes such as phone, short messages.Background monitoring terminal 5 by showing that output module 502 can show the monitoring informations such as text, video, realize to the mineral resources in monitoring range into The purpose of row real time monitoring.
